Mathieu Segaud <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> no no no, NEVER use root as a user account :) > > you have to setuid the freqset utility e installs in the module > subdirectory > > # chmod u+s freqset > > This way whenever it is executed, it is executed as its owner, root, > not as its real user, you. > > but some see it as a security hazard > > To avoid sec problems, I set it to r-s--x--x rights and it is owned > by root.
Why would removing the read rights for normal users help with security? Anybody can download the source and build an identical copy anyway.
